Trailer for Hard Boiled Thriller ‘Sicko’ Builds Towards Ultra Violence

Loco Films has come on board as the sales agent for Aitore Zholdaskali’s hard boiled thriller Sicko, which has its international premiere in the Bright Future Competition section of the International Film Festival Rotterdam, reports Variety.
Set in Almaty, the film follows a cash-strapped couple who hatch a plan to solve their money troubles, but soon become embroiled in a toxic web of social media, violent criminality and spiralling greed.
The trailer is a slow roll to ultra violence, with the closing seconds promising some extreme bloodshed!
“In pure Korean-style genre thrills, the film fuses gory violence, twists and black humor,” Loco Films’ Laurent Danielou comments. “Behind its stylish brutality lies a razor-edged social commentary on gender and late-stage capitalism, rooted specifically in today’s Kazakhstan. The film was a huge success in Kazakh cinemas.”
